Cloudprober: Reliable System Monitoring, Simplified!
Cloudprober supercharges your monitoring with active probes (a.k.a. synthetic monitoring) to ensure your systems—homelabs, microservices, APIs, websites, or cloud-to-on-prem connections—run smoothly. See this post for why probers provide one of the most reliable monitoring signals.
Trusted by Leading Organizations
Why Cloudprober?
-
Versatile Probes: Built-in HTTP, PING, TCP, DNS, gRPC, and UDP probes, plus custom checks via external probes.
-
Auto-Discover Targets: Effortlessly monitor Kubernetes, GCP, or file-based resources without constant redeployment.
-
Integrate with Existing Systems: Out-of-the-box integration with Prometheus, Grafana, DataDog, AWS CloudWatch, PostgreSQL, and Google Cloud Monitoring.
-
Easy Alerts: Stay informed via email, Slack, PagerDuty, OpsGenie, or any other HTTP based system.
-
Lightweight & Scalable: Written in Go, compiles to a single binary, and runs efficiently as a standalone app or Docker container.
-
Custom Metrics: Flexible latency histograms and configurable labels for precise insights.
-
Extensible: Easily add new probe types, targets, or monitoring systems.

NOTE: Cloudprober's active development moved from
google/cloudprober to
cloudprober/cloudprober in
Nov, 2021. We lost a bunch of Github stars (1400) in the process. See
story of cloudprober
to learn more about the history of Cloudprober.
